移动自组织网络(MANET)的节点通常能量有限,为了均衡网络中节点的能量消耗并延长网络的生存时间,有必要针对MANET网络进行相关的能量感知均衡设计。文章在网络层对MANET进行能量感知研究,通过对AODV路由协议进行改进,提出具有能量有效的AODV路由发现机制,最终设计改进的AODV路由协议——EQ-AODV。仿真结果表明,本研究设计的路由协议在平衡能量消耗和延长网络生存时间方面较原始AODV协议有较大提升。 相似文献

基于定位的移动Adhoc网络路由技术 总被引:1,自引:0,他引:1
路由协议是移动Ad hoc网络(MANET)研究的一个热点.传统的MANET的路由协议都是基于图形学建模的,只能获知各个节点之间的连通关系,而不能获知节点之间地理位置的关系.本文将要介绍基于定位的MANET路由协议,这些协议利用定位信息,从各方面改善MANET路由协议的性能. 相似文献

服务通告和发现在MANET(Mobile Ad hoc Networks)网络中,是一个十分重要的组成部分.现有的服务通告和发现协议不是为MANET网络设计的.文章提出了一个适合MANET、基于ZRP(Zone Routing Protocol)的服务通告及发现协议.服务的通告与发现存在于ZRP路由控制分组中,避免了周期性的通告给MANET网络带来的负载,节约了有限的带宽和设备的能耗. 相似文献

路由策略是网络技术研究的焦点问题之一。由于移动自组网络MANET中节点的动态性和节点资源的有限性,以及多媒体应用服务质量的需求,导致在MANET网络实现路由存在诸多困难。综述了目前文献中基于MANET网络的普通路由协议和满足服务质量需求的QoS路由协议/算法,详细说明了不同协议的实现过程和存在的优缺点,并指出了目前路由策略研究中存在的问题和将来的发展方向。 相似文献

无线自组网(MANET)是一种无中心的自组织网络,其在各种场景下得到了越来越多的应用。DSDV路由协议作为一种先验式路由协议,具有协议流程设计简单、延迟很低等特性,能较好地适用于移动性较弱的小规模自组织网络。文中介绍了DSDV路由协议的工作原理,提出了基于Linux系统Netlink通信机制的DSDV路由协议的软件实现架构方案,并阐述了关键模块的实现。另外,还在多台实体计算机上运行DSDV路由协议软件,并测试了多跳路由、延迟时间和通信速率。测试结果表明,文中所提方案具有可行性和有效性。 相似文献

A Shoelace-Based QoS Routing Protocol for Mobile Ad Hoc Networks Using Directional Antenna 总被引:1,自引:0,他引:1
In this paper, we propose a new quality-of-service (QoS) routing protocol for mobile ad hoc network (MANET) using directional
antennas. The proposed scheme offers a bandwidth-based routing protocol for QoS support in MANET using the concept of multi-path.
Our MAC sub-layer adopts the CDMA-over-TDMA channel model. The on-demand QoS routing protocol calculates the end-to-end bandwidth
and allocates bandwidth from the source node to the destination node. The paths are combined with multiple cross links, called
shoelace, when the network bandwidth is strictly limited. Due to the property of the directional antenna, these cross links
can transmit data simultaneously without any data interference. We develop a shoelace-based on-demand QoS routing protocol
by identifying shoelaces in a MANET so as to construct a QoS route, which satisfied the bandwidth requirement, more easily.
The shoelace-based route from the source to the destination is a route whose sub-path is constructed by shoelace structure.
With the identified shoelaces, our shoelace-based scheme offers a higher success rate to construct a QoS route. Finally, simulation
results demonstrate that the proposed routing protocol outperform existing QoS routing protocols in terms of success rate,
throughput, and average latency. 相似文献

Energy and routing efficiency is a long-research topic from past decades in the area of MANET. The prior research contribution focusing on addressing both the issues are associated with issues like (1) few benchmarked studies, (2) adoption of conventional routing protocols based on shortest path to mitigate both issues, and (3) inefficient design principles of routing. Hence, this paper proposes a novel routing protocol in mobile ad hoc network (MANET) termed as MECOR i.e. minimal energy consumption with optimized routing. MECOR presents a simple communication strategy based on mathematical and signaling properties of mobile nodes in MANET to jointly address the energy and routing issues in MANET. The outcome of the MECOR was compared with conventional routing algorithm as well as recent studies of energy efficient routing policy to find that MECOR can minimize 58.82 % of energy in most challenging mobility scenarios of MANET. 相似文献

基于OPNET仿真平台的AODV协议的性能研究 总被引:4,自引:0,他引:4
AODV(Ad hoc On-demand Distance Vector Routing)路由协议是面向移动Adhoc网络的,在介绍了移动Ad hoc网络的特征、现有路由协议和AODV路由协议的发展过程之后,重点分析了AODV协议的特征、路由建立、维护过程,并基于OPNET平台仿真了AODV协议的性能(包括路由发现时间、协议效率、平均跳数、数据吞吐量),总结了目前AODV协议存在的问题及其改进的主要方法,最后对AODV协议改进的前景进行了预测。 相似文献

本文提出了一种Mobile Ad hoc网络(Manet)链路状态分组路由算法(Link State-hased Cluster Routing Algo-rithm-LSCR),该算法对Manet节点进行动态分组,每一组选举出一个具有最大度数的头结点(CH-Cluster Header),该cH负责本组信息的管理、组内结点与组外结点之间的通信以及与其他组的CH之间交换链路状态信息等工作.本算法将改进的链路状态协议与分组路由协议有机结合,有效提高了Manet网络的路由效率.分析和实验结果表明,这种算法具有路由收敛速度快、维护成本相对较低,数据包发送成功率高,发送等待时间短等特点。 相似文献
